随着区块链技术的迅猛发展,越来越多的企业逐渐认识到这一新兴技术所带来的巨大潜力与机遇,从而纷纷成立了专门的区块链技术团队。这些团队针对不同的发展需求,设置了多种不同类型的岗位。本文将对区块链技术公司常见的岗位进行详细解析,为有意进入这一领域的求职者提供参考。
区块链开发工程师是区块链技术公司中最为核心的岗位之一。该职位主要负责区块链应用的设计、开发与维护。根据开发方向的不同,区块链开发工程师可以分为后端开发、智能合约开发和前端开发等角色。后端开发主要关注区块链的网络架构和交互协议,智能合约开发则负责编写与测试合约,而前端开发则需要实现用户界面,确保用户体验流畅。
为成为一名合格的区块链开发工程师,求职者需要掌握多种编程语言,如Solidity、JavaScript、Python等,熟悉区块链技术的基本原理,包括共识机制、加密技术等。此外,了解常见的区块链平台,如以太坊、Hyperledger等,也是一大优势。
区块链架构师主要负责整个区块链系统的设计与架构,确保项目能够满足业务需求并具备高效性和安全性。该岗位需要对区块链相关技术有深刻的理解,以及具备系统分析和逻辑思维能力。区块链架构师需要协同开发团队,实现技术方案的落地。
为了胜任这一角色,求职者通常需要具备较强的技术背景和项目经验,能够独立完成从需求分析到系统设计的全过程。此外,在团队协作和沟通能力上,区块链架构师也需要展现出色的能力,以引导和推动项目顺利进行。
区块链产品经理是连接技术与市场的重要桥梁。其主要职责包括产品需求分析、市场调研、产品规划与设计等。区块链产品经理需要深入了解区块链领域的市场动态,把握用户需求,并制定出切实可行的产品策略。
这类岗位通常要求求职者具备良好的商业敏感度与市场洞察力,同时也需要一定的技术背景,以便与技术团队有效沟通。此外,项目管理能力和团队合作精神是成功的产品经理不可或缺的特质。
区块链运维工程师负责对区块链系统进行监控与管理,确保其高可用性和安全性。该岗位需要处理各种故障恢复和性能问题,保证区块链节点的正常运行。运维工程师在处理网络流量、区块链数据和安全策略时,都需要表现出较强的技术能力。
在这一领域,求职者需要熟悉区块链平台和分布式存储系统,能够处理常见的问题及应急处理。此外,沟通协调能力也不容忽视,因为运维工程师常常需要与开发人员和产品经理紧密合作。
区块链测试工程师负责对开发出的区块链应用进行全面的测试,确保其功能的完备性和安全性。测试工程师需要设计测试用例,进行白盒测试、黑盒测试等,及时发现并修复漏洞。随着区块链技术的发展,测试工作加倍复杂,因此该岗位的需求日益增长。
求职者通常需要熟练掌握自动化测试工具与方法,具备测试设计与执行能力,能用编程语言进行测试脚本编写。此外,良好的分析能力和逻辑推理能力在此岗位中也显得尤为重要。
区块链市场营销专员主要负责公司的品牌推广和市场拓展。他们需要制定和执行市场营销策略,提升公司在行业内的影响力。该岗位需要对区块链行业及其市场趋势有深入的了解,能够针对不同的目标群体设计合适的营销方案。
求职者通常需具备优秀的文字表达能力和创意能力,能够撰写吸引人的营销文案。此外,数据分析能力也非常重要,以便通过数据评估营销效果,从而调整和策略。
随着区块链行业的不断成熟,各类岗位的需求也在逐渐增加。无论是技术类的开发、测试岗位,还是市场类的产品管理、营销岗位,每一个角色都在为推动区块链技术的发展贡献力量。对希望在区块链技术领域寻找职业发展的求职者而言,了解这些岗位的职责与要求无疑是非常有帮助的步骤。